Transaction 74ef286d20d748a29d5ef4ed2facb0b99fb223426e33d116a8b1e93f9c7b3986

44 Input
2 Outputs
  • 74ef286d20d748a29d5ef4ed2facb0b99fb223426e33d116a8b1e93f9c7b3986:0
  • value  898078
    address  33cR3r8xPiiggSbbxDiPtcbQyTHbofjWFF
  • 74ef286d20d748a29d5ef4ed2facb0b99fb223426e33d116a8b1e93f9c7b3986:1
  • value  549772826
    address  36EECW3scxmTL9c3WBG3f1DmAEKdmRgCdm